There is a little story behind this beautiful blanket!   I have a very dear and wonderful friend of long standing .. in fact we were schoolgirls when we met, and we both, lets just say, have many 'wisdom highlights'!!
Two years ago, she had occasion to offer her home to my son who had just relocated to the UK .... it was such a relief for me to know that while he found his footing he was in a warm and welcome home.  Well, I committed myself, and promised her, that I would make her a blanket to thank her for her kindness.

Three false starts and nearly two years later and I was in despair;  I was not happy with any patterns I had started. Meanwhile a beautiful creation was in progress on FB, and I noticed that my friend was taking a particular interest in the posts as well.  Ahaa ... there it was .. the light-bulb moment ... I suddenly understood this was the blanket I was destined to make for her. 

And so I set out to make my version of the beautiful 

I didn't want to change too much, the colours in the blanket are inspired!  I was awakened to how blue and turquoise roses are absolutely OK and stunningly beautiful ... I would never have been so brave before!  And furthermore ... random is wonderful and liberating!
